Μετάβαση στο κύριο περιεχόμενο

Ενημέρωση

Πώς να Κάνετε μια Ενημέρωση μιας Υπάρχουσας ERDDAP™ στον εξυπηρετητή σας

Μεταβολές

  1. Κάντε τις αλλαγές που αναφέρονται στο Μεταβολές στο τμήμα με τίτλο " Πράγματα ERDDAP™ Οι διαχειριστές πρέπει να γνωρίζουν και να κάνουν" για όλους τους ERDDAP™ εκδόσεις μετά την έκδοση που χρησιμοποιούσατε.  

Java

  1. Εάν είστε αναβάθμιση από ERDDAP™ έκδοση 2.18 ή κάτω, θα πρέπει να μεταβείτε σε Java 21 (ή νεότερος) και το σχετικό Tomcat 10. Δείτε την τακτική ERDDAP™ οδηγίες εγκατάστασης για Java και Τομκάτ . Θα πρέπει επίσης να αντιγράψετε το tomcat/content/erddap κατάλογος από την παλιά εγκατάσταση Tomcat σας στη νέα εγκατάσταση Tomcat.

Λήψη

  1. Λήψη Erddap.war (στα Αγγλικά). tomcat/webapps . (έκδοση 2.28.1, 622.676,238 bytes, MD5=48b4226045f950c8a8d69ef9521b9bc9, με ημερομηνία 09-05-2025)  

μηνύματα.xml

    • Συχνές: Εάν είστε αναβάθμιση από ERDDAP™ έκδοση 1.46 (ή πάνω) και απλά χρησιμοποιείτε τα τυποποιημένα μηνύματα, τα νέα τυποποιημένα μηνύματα.xml θα εγκατασταθεί αυτόματα (μεταξύ των αρχείων .class μέσω erddap. πόλεμος) .  
    • Σπάνιες: Εάν είστε αναβάθμιση από ERDDAP™ έκδοση 1.44 (ή κάτω) , Πρέπει να διαγράψετε το παλιό αρχείο μηνυμάτων.xml: tomcat/content/erddap /μήνυμα.xml . Τα νέα πρότυπα μηνύματα.xml θα εγκατασταθούν αυτόματα (μεταξύ των αρχείων .class μέσω erddap. πόλεμος) .  
    • Σπάνιες: Αν κάνετε πάντα αλλαγές στο τυπικό αρχείο μηνυμάτων.xml (στη θέση του) , πρέπει να κάνετε αυτές τις αλλαγές στο νέο αρχείο μηνυμάτων.xml (που είναι WEB-INF/classes/gov/noaa/pfel/erddap/util/messages.xml μετά την αποσυμπίεση του erddap.war από το Tomcat).  
    • Σπάνιες: Αν διατηρείτε ένα προσαρμοσμένο αρχείο μηνυμάτων.xml σε tomcat/content/erddap /, Πρέπει να καταλάβεις. (μέσω diff) ποιες αλλαγές έχουν γίνει στα προεπιλεγμένα μηνύματα.xml (που βρίσκονται στο νέο erddap. πόλεμο ως WEB-INF/classes/gov/noaa/pfel/erddap/util/messages.xml) και τροποποιούν το προσαρμοσμένο αρχείο σας.xml αναλόγως.  

Εγκατάσταση

  1. Εγκατάσταση του νέου ERDDAP™ στο Tomcat: \* Μην χρησιμοποιήσετε Tomcat Manager. Αργά ή γρήγορα θα υπάρξουν προβλήματα μνήμης PermGen. Καλύτερα να κλείσουμε και να ξεκινήσουμε το Tomcat. \* Αντικατάσταση αναφορών στο tomcat παρακάτω με τον πραγματικό κατάλογο Tomcat στον υπολογιστή σας.  

Linux και Macs

  1. Κλείσιμο Tomcat: Από μια γραμμή εντολών, χρήση: tomcat/bin/shutdown.sh Και χρησιμοποίησε το ps -ef | grep tomcat για να δείτε αν/όταν η διαδικασία έχει σταματήσει. (Μπορεί να πάρει κάνα δυο λεπτά.)
  2. Αφαιρέστε το αποσυμπιεσμένο ERDDAP™ εγκατάσταση: Σε tomcat/webapps, χρήση rm - rf erddap
  3. Διαγράψτε το παλιό erddap. αρχείο πολέμου: Σε tomcat/webapps, χρήση rm erddap. πόλεμος
  4. Ελήφθη το νέο erddap. αρχείο πολέμου από τον προσωρινό κατάλογο σε tomcat/webapps
  5. Επανεκκίνηση Tomcat και ERDDAP : χρήση tomcat/bin/startup.sh
  6. Προβολή ERDDAP™ στον περιηγητή σας για να ελέγξετε ότι η επανεκκίνηση πέτυχε. (Συχνά, θα πρέπει να δοκιμάσετε μερικές φορές και περιμένετε ένα λεπτό πριν δείτε ERDDAP™ .)
     

Παράθυρα

  1. Κλείσιμο Tomcat: Από μια γραμμή εντολών, χρήση: tomcat\binbin\ shutdown.bat
  2. Αφαιρέστε το αποσυμπιεσμένο ERDDAP™ εγκατάσταση: Σε tomcat/webapps, χρήση Δελ /S/Q erddap
  3. Διαγράψτε το παλιό erddap. αρχείο πολέμου: Σε tomcat\webapps, χρήση del erddap. πόλεμος
  4. Ελήφθη το νέο erddap. αρχείο πολέμου από τον προσωρινό κατάλογο στο tomcat\webapps
  5. Επανεκκίνηση Tomcat και ERDDAP : χρήση tomcat\bin\startup.bat
  6. Προβολή ERDDAP™ στον περιηγητή σας για να ελέγξετε ότι η επανεκκίνηση πέτυχε. (Συχνά, θα πρέπει να δοκιμάσετε μερικές φορές και περιμένετε ένα λεπτό πριν δείτε ERDDAP™ .)

Ενημέρωση προβλημάτων ERDDAP ♪ ♪ Δείτε μας τμήμα για τη λήψη πρόσθετης υποστήριξης .